Transaction 41d66c3aaf7db7ad950cf80fc9f4254160d57c1146588273f1cbb28e429e8769
1 Input
2 Outputs
- 41d66c3aaf7db7ad950cf80fc9f4254160d57c1146588273f1cbb28e429e8769:0
- 41d66c3aaf7db7ad950cf80fc9f4254160d57c1146588273f1cbb28e429e8769:1
value 44679
address 3EuNmWpkVB7EWnpjABCUCGNuju66zSTy7k
value 597001
address 1DRFJqSRK6ngp9tXHtiBxvqNqmgqCvHjvR